After winning a paltry 90 votes in the Manipur assembly elections, Irom Sharmila has vowed to never enter politics again. Sharmila fought from CM Okram Ibobi Singh’s Thoubal constituency, representing her fledgling party – The People’s Resurgence and Justice Alliance (PRJA)

Though her party had the support of the AAP, the ‘Iron Lady’ failed to convince her electorate, and a large section of the people who supported her.

Sharmila told Hindustan Times

I am not ashamed of my defeat, but I am fed up of elections and won’t contest again in the future.
